How else you could buy sealed Japanese Pokémon

Reference prices for a current-era JP booster box, May 2026. Moon Stone isn’t the cheapest. It’s parity pricing on fulfillment you don’t have to babysit.

Source Typical price What you trade
DIY proxy importing $180–220 Four to six weeks in transit. Japanese customs forms. No recourse if it arrives crushed.
Concierge proxy services $230–260 Markup with no transparency. Slow replies. Still two to four weeks.
eBay sealed listings $200–250 Re-shrink and counterfeit risk. eBay is the only adjudicator. Condition is a coin flip.
TCGPlayer “market” $150–180 Aggregate listings, not a sealed-only index. Most of what’s priced here is opened or re-sealed inventory, which is a different product than what you’re buying.
Moon Stone (member) Landed cost Shrink-verified before it ships. Damaged or wrong on arrival, email me and I’ll make it right.
